Throttle Butterfly

Throttle butterfly has been modified in two ways. First, incorporation of a spring loaded poppet valve, which compensates for high manifold vacuum conditions (engine overrun at closed throttle conditions). Second a 0.098" hole has been added to compensate for the effect of a higher idling speed on distributor vacuum advance characteristics.
